Jeremiah Smith’s freshman season at Ohio State has been nothing short of spectacular, both on the football field and in the realm of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) opportunities. As the top-rated recruit in the 2024 class, Smith’s transition to college football was eagerly anticipated, and he has exceeded all expectations.
On the field, Smith quickly established himself as a dominant force. Standing 6-foot-3 and weighing 215 pounds, his combination of size, speed, and agility made him a matchup nightmare for defenders. Throughout the season, he showcased his exceptional skills, culminating in a standout performance in the College Football Playoff quarterfinals against Oregon. In that game, Smith recorded 187 receiving yards and two touchdowns, leading Ohio State to a decisive victory and propelling them into the semifinals against Texas .
Off the field, Smith’s impact has been equally impressive. His rapid rise in college football has translated into significant NIL earnings, making him one of the most marketable athletes in the country. As of early 2025, Smith’s NIL valuation was estimated at $3.7 million, placing him among the top college athletes nationwide .
A key factor in Smith’s NIL success has been his strategic partnerships with major brands. One of his most notable endorsements is with Red Bull, making him the first college football player to sign with the energy drink company. This deal not only highlights Smith’s marketability but also sets a precedent for future college athletes seeking similar opportunities .
In addition to Red Bull, Smith has secured deals with several other prominent brands. He partnered with Ricart Automotive, receiving a Dodge Durango 392 in exchange for promotional appearances and social media posts. This partnership underscores the growing trend of car dealerships leveraging NIL deals to promote their brands through college athletes .
Smith has also aligned himself with lifestyle and sports brands such as Lululemon, American Eagle, and Battle Sports. These collaborations have further expanded his reach and appeal, connecting him with diverse audiences and enhancing his personal brand .
Beyond commercial endorsements, Smith’s influence extends into the digital realm. With a social media following exceeding 376,000 across platforms like Instagram, TikTok, and X, he has become a significant presence online. His posts, showcasing his athletic prowess and personal interests, resonate with fans and brands alike, amplifying his NIL value .
